Stamm. It covers how gender stereotypes hinder women’s advances in work place. In this article, the author discusses about gender stereotypes from both descriptive and prescriptive points of view. Descriptive stereotype talks about what men and women are like and prescriptive stereotype discusses about what men and women should be like.
